在当今软件开发中,GitHub 是一个不可或缺的工具。无论是开源项目还是个人项目,开发者们都依赖它来管理和存储代码。然而,随着项目的进展和需求的变化,您可能会遇到需要删除某个仓库的情况。那么,GitHub怎么删除仓库存在项目 呢?本文将为您提供详细的指导。
一、删除仓库的前提条件
在您决定删除仓库之前,请确保您满足以下条件:
- 确保备份:在删除仓库之前,确保已经备份了重要的代码或数据。
- 确认权限:您必须是该仓库的管理员或者拥有者。
- 项目状态:请考虑项目的状态,确保没有正在进行的工作。
二、删除仓库的步骤
以下是删除GitHub仓库的具体步骤:
1. 登录到GitHub账号
首先,您需要登录到您的GitHub账号。访问 GitHub官网,输入您的账号信息进行登录。
2. 访问要删除的仓库
- 点击页面右上角的个人头像。
- 从下拉菜单中选择 “Your repositories”。
- 找到并点击您想要删除的仓库。
3. 进入仓库设置
在仓库页面,点击上方的 “Settings” 选项。
4. 滚动到页面底部
在设置页面,向下滚动,您将看到 “Danger Zone” 部分。
5. 点击删除仓库
在 Danger Zone 部分,找到 “Delete this repository” 按钮,点击它。
6. 确认删除
系统会要求您确认删除操作。您需要输入仓库的名称以确认。输入后,点击 “I understand the consequences, delete this repository” 按钮。
三、删除仓库后的影响
删除仓库后,您将面临以下后果:
- 无法恢复:删除的仓库将无法恢复,所有的代码和数据将被永久删除。
- 影响其他协作者:如果其他协作者正在使用此仓库,删除操作会影响他们的工作。
- 与其他项目的关联:如果您的仓库与其他项目有依赖关系,删除后可能会造成问题。
四、常见问题解答(FAQ)
Q1: 删除仓库会影响Fork吗?
删除的仓库会导致与之关联的所有 Forks 的内容被删除,但原始 Fork 仍然存在。也就是说,用户在其账户下的 Fork 不会被删除,除非他们自行选择删除。
Q2: 如何找回误删的仓库?
不幸的是,一旦仓库被删除,您将无法恢复它。因此,强烈建议在删除前做好备份。
Q3: 删除私有仓库是否需要付费?
如果您删除的是 私有仓库,请注意,GitHub 不会收取额外的费用。但如果您正在使用收费账户,删除的私有仓库不会退还之前的费用。
Q4: 删除仓库会影响我的GitHub账号吗?
删除仓库不会影响您的 GitHub账号。您的其他仓库和信息仍然会保留。
Q5: 如何知道哪些项目需要删除?
建议定期审查您的仓库,考虑以下因素:
- 活跃程度:是否还有人在更新该项目?
- 使用频率:您是否仍在使用该项目?
- 团队反馈:团队成员是否认为该项目仍有价值?
五、总结
删除 GitHub 仓库是一个需要谨慎操作的过程。通过本文提供的详细步骤和注意事项,希望能够帮助您顺利完成仓库的删除。在进行删除操作之前,务必确认已备份所有重要数据,以免造成不必要的损失。如果您还有其他问题,欢迎查阅 GitHub 的官方文档或联系支持团队。